DGPM Recruitment 2025: Apply for 130 Additional Assistant Director Posts

The Directorate General of Performance Management (DGPM) has announced recruitment for the position of Additional Assistant Director (AAD) on a deputation basis. This opportunity is open to well-qualified and enthusiastic candidates for various directorates under CCA, DGPM, CBIC. There are 130 vacancies available, and selected candidates will receive a salary in Pay Matrix Level 08 to 09.

Applicants must meet the eligibility criteria, including possessing a Bachelor’s degree from a recognized university and at least three years of experience in relevant fields such as Customs, GST, Excise duties, and Taxation Compliance. The deputation period will typically be for three years, and the maximum age limit for applying is 56 years as of the last date of application submission.

Candidates who meet the eligibility criteria must apply through the proper channel before April 8, 2025. Below are the key details regarding the recruitment process.

Salary for DGPM Recruitment 2025

Selected candidates will receive a monthly salary as per Pay Matrix Level – 8 (Rs 47,600 – Rs 1,51,100). After completing four years of regular service, the pay will be revised to Pay Matrix Level – 9 (Rs 53,100 – Rs 1,67,800).

Additional Allowances:

  • Dearness Allowance (DA)
  • House Rent Allowance (HRA)
  • Transport Allowance (TPT)
  • Other allowances as per Central Government norms

Eligibility Criteria for DGPM Recruitment 2025

To apply for the Additional Assistant Director post, candidates must fulfill the following criteria:

Who Can Apply?

  • Officers of the Central Government, State Government, or Union Territories who are:
    1. Holding analogous posts on a regular basis in the parent cadre/department.
    2. Having at least two years of regular service in Pay Matrix Level – 7 (Rs 44,900 – Rs 1,42,400) or an equivalent post in the parent cadre/department.

Educational Qualification and Experience

Educational Qualification:

  • Bachelor’s degree from a recognized university or institute.

Required Experience:

  • Minimum three years of experience in tax administration related to:
    • Customs duty
    • Central Excise duties
    • Goods and Service Tax (GST) and Integrated Goods and Service Tax (IGST)
    • Tax Intelligence and Investigation
    • Enforcement of border control for goods and conveyances
    • Adjudication and appeals related to tax disputes
    • Tax audit and compliance

Tenure for DGPM Recruitment 2025

  • The appointment will be on a deputation basis.
  • The maximum tenure is three years, including any deputation service in a prior ex-cadre post.
  • Departmental officers in the direct promotion line are not eligible to apply for deputation.
  • Deputationists will not be considered for promotion during the deputation period.

Age Limit for DGPM Recruitment 2025

  • The maximum age limit for deputation-based appointments is 56 years as of the last date of application submission.
